Randolph-Macon College has a unique Commuter Life Program which involves a Commuter Student Association which works specifically with commuter students using the Commuter Lounge, in the Brown Campus Center, as a base. Commuter life is enhanced by social and educational programs designed to strengthen this community. The Commuter Student Association works as a liason between commuter students and College administrators.
Professional Staff:
The Dean of Students Office directs the Commuter Life program. The Director of Student Development works with and advises the Commuter Student Association, works in conjunction with the Brown Campus Center Manager to maintain the Commuter Lounge, and provides services and advocacy for Commuter Students on campus.
